French designer Frederick Gautier translates brutalist architecture into a series of arresting objects for the home. Drawing inspiration from colossal modernist forms, each vase in this collection for Serax can be interpreted as a building in miniature. Cast from cement, this tubular desisgn creates a strong presence with its sculptural, faceted form. Defined by eight radial panels, its geometric shape is accentuated by a raw surface texture and gray concrete hue. The 'Vase 01 Fck' vase takes on a new identity when filled with fresh or dried florals, and can be displayed as an impressive sculpture in its own right.
